Step one, fully charge your packs to 4.2v

Step two, run them all the way until LVC, and take note of runtime and how hard you feel you ran it. If you have a GoPro, you could video the run for more help there.

Step three, check the cell voltages immediately after LVC. The sooner the better. The longer the cells recover, the higher this value will be.

Step four, put the battery back on a balance charge to 4.2v and see how many MAH the charger puts back in.
 
I find that when I run in grass, I get about 25% less run time than when I run at the skate park, regardless what I'm driving. When I run in grass, it's a lot more WOT running, longer run ups, big jumps. At the skate park, the run ups are short and not a lot of WOT running.

I don't have a 3S arrma, but I do have a couple 3S trucks. When I ran 1/10th electronics in my stampede 4x4, I'd get about 28 minutes at the grass bmx with the max10 sct/3660sl 3200kv motor and 7200mah 3S SMC lipo. Then I changed to a 3665/3100kv motor went up 1 on the pinion and it dropped to 20 minutes, but ran cooler. Could be the grass was taller or I ran harder, etc.

Now I run a blx185 and 2200kv 4074 and get 18 minutes on a 6200mah 3S pack at the same place... but I tend to drive it like I stole it and it's geared taller now that I have more torque. Geared for 45mph. At the skate park, I get 22-24 minutes with the exact same truck/setup. So, the place you drive and how you drive impacts it quite a bit.
